What did the AAA ask farmers to do to help achieve its goal?

sell more of their products overseas
change the kinds of crops they grew
focus almost exclusively on livestock
grow fewer crops and raise fewer animals

HURRY PLEASE AND THANKS

Answers

Answer: grow fewer crops and raise fewer animals

Explanation:

The AAA asked farmers to reduce agricultural production by growing fewer crops and raising fewer animals. This reduction in output was intended to address the problem of overproduction and stabilize agricultural prices. Farmers were often paid subsidies or offered incentives to voluntarily reduce their production levels in order to achieve the goals of the AAA.

How did cotton unite the south and the north regions

Answers

Cotton united the South and the Northern regions as the northern economy relied on manufacturing and the agricultural southern economy depended on the production of cotton.

What is the connection between North and South regarding cotton?

The North and South did things very differently. Despite the differences, the North's economy was supported by the South, and the South's economy was supported by the North. Since the North had an industrial economy focused on manufacturing, it needed the crops grown in the South to produce goods. For instance, a northern textile factory would need cotton from the South to develop its fabrics.

Therefore, many of the materials grown in the South were sold to northern industry owners.

The Immigration Act of 1990

The Immigration Act of 1990 was penned into law by George H. W. Bush on November 29, 1990. It was first introduced by Senator Ted Kennedy in 1989. It was a national reform of the Immigration and Nationality Act of 1965.

Effect of the Immigration Act of 1990

The Immigration Act of 1990 helped permit the entry of 20 million people over the next two decades, the largest number recorded in any 20 year period since the nation's founding. Seekers could remain in the United States until conditions in their homelands improved.

Chang'an was an ancient capital for more than ten Chinese dynasties. Also known as the famous eastern terminal of the Silk Road, it was situated in the Shaanxi province just relatively near Xi'an. Chang'an was the Chinese capital for the Han, Sui and Tang dynasty leaders.

Strategic and economic importance of ancient Chang'an. The mountainous country surrounding the Wei River basin led to the existence of only two practicable roads through to the south, and two through mountainous Gansu to the west, forming the beginning of the ancient Silk Routes.

Stalemate:

A situation in which neither side can gain advantage or win.

Demilitarized zone:

An area where military forces and weapons are not allowed which is often established as a buffer between two hostile countries or regions.

Censure:

The expression of strong disapproval or criticism which is often formalized by an official statement or resolution.

Subversion:

The act of attempting to overthrow or undermine a government or political system by covert or deceptive means.

Iron Curtain:

This describe the division of Europe between Soviet-dominated Eastern Europe and Western Europe following the end of World War II.

Cold War:

A state of political and military tension between the Western powers (led by the United States) and the Communist bloc (led by the Soviet Union) that lasted from the end of World War II until the early 1990s.
